Uploaded image for project: 'SAFe Program'
  1. SAFe Program
  2. SP-3354

LOW CBF Correlator Delay Polynomial Updates

Change Owns to Parent OfsSet start and due date...
    XporterXMLWordPrintable

Details

    • Obs Mgt & Controls
      • Delays have higher precision
      • Performance meets the requirements (currently factor ~3 away)
      • Without delays the correlator doesn't function
      • Gitlab testing routine developed
      • Meets the requirements
      • Demonstration of software and firmware
    • 2
    • 1.75
    • 0
    • Team_PERENTIE
    • Sprint 2
    • Hide

      The feature is partially completed for PI#19, the feature demo is written here:
      https://docs.google.com/presentation/d/14MbA94LmlOMZUubK7b011FOQdKINu9pEpF27AmSCq14/edit

      The remaining part will be replanned and completed in Spint 19.6 (IP Sprint) and PI#20

      Show
      The feature is partially completed for PI#19, the feature demo is written here: https://docs.google.com/presentation/d/14MbA94LmlOMZUubK7b011FOQdKINu9pEpF27AmSCq14/edit The remaining part will be replanned and completed in Spint 19.6 (IP Sprint) and PI#20
    • PI22 - UNCOVERED

    • Team_PERENTIE solution-goal-1
    • SOL-G1

    Description

      The current firmware uses a linear approximation to this polynomial, and is fixed for the entire test case, i.e. there are no updates.

      The proposed changes are:

      • Calculate the polynomial fit over the interval 0 to 10 seconds (instead of -5 to 5) 
      • Note that in practice we have no control over this, since polynomial will be provided at a rate determined by higher layers in the control software.
      • Use a least squares approximation to the polynomial to calculate the linear approximation used in the firmware
      • Update the linear approximation used in the firmware for every integration interval

      The work required to do this is:

      • Update the matlab algorithm to find the least squares linear approximation instead of the tangent.
      • Implement the matlab code in the control software, to provide regular (849ms) updates to the register settings that define the delays used in the firmware.
      • debug firmware - control register updates haven't been properly tested.

      Attachments

        Issue Links

          Structure

            Activity

              People

                a.bridger Bridger, Alan
                y.chen Chen, Yuqing
                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Feature Progress

                  Story Point Burn-up: (100.00%)

                  Feature Estimate: 2.0

                  IssuesStory Points
                  To Do00.0
                  In Progress   00.0
                  Complete1418.0
                  Total1418.0

                  Dates

                    Created:
                    Updated:

                    Structure Helper Panel